33-22-510 . Insured's family -- conversion entitlement. Subject to the conditions set forth in this section, the conversion privilege is also available:
(1)to the surviving spouse, if any, at the death of the employee or member, with respect to the spouse and children whose coverage under the group policy terminates by reason of the death, otherwise to each surviving child whose coverage under the group policy terminates by reason of the death, or if the group policy provides for continuation of dependent's coverage following the employee's or member's death, at the end of the continuation;
